Revel Web开源框架
相关学习资料:
一步一步学习Revel Web开源框架
http://www.cnblogs.com/ztiandan/archive/2013/01/17/2864498.html
http://www.cnblogs.com/ztiandan/archive/2013/01/17/2864498.html
Revel框架简介
http://golanger.cn/?p=208
http://golanger.cn/?p=208
Go语言Web框架:beego
支持如下特性
- MVC
- REST
- 智能路由
- 日志调试
- 配置管理
- 模板自动渲染
- layout设计
- 中间件插入逻辑
- 方便的JSON/XML服务
Golanger Web Framework
Golanger 是一个轻量级的 Web 应用框架,使用 Go 语言编写。
Golanger框架主要实现了MVC模式(三层架构模式)(Model-View-Controller), 它是软件工程中的一种软件架构模式,把软件系统分为三个基本部分:模型(Model)、视图(View)和控制器(Controller)
Golanger约定的命名规则:
- 控制器(Controller): 存放在controllers目录中, 负责转发请求,对请求进行处理.
- 模型(Model): 存放在models目录中, 程序员编写程序应有的功能(实现算法等等)、数据管理和数据库设计(可以实现具体的功能).
- 视图(View): 存放在views目录中, 界面设计人员进行图形界面设计.
- 静态文件放在static目录中.
- add-on存放第三方库文件,默认是把GOPATH设置为这个目录.
Go语言的Web框架 - Goku
国人(QLeelulu, FaWave作者)开发的Go MVC框架,仿照ASP.NET MVC
goku 是一个 Go 语言的 Web MVC 框架,很像 ASP.NET MVC, 简单而且强大。
http://qleelulu.github.com/goku/
http://qleelulu.github.com/goku/
基本功能:
- mvc (Lightweight model)
- 路由
- 多模板引擎和布局
- 简单数据库 API
- 表单验证
- 控制器或 Action 的过滤
- 中间件
No comments:
Post a Comment